    I started at 89%, not good according to the supplied advice card, but didn’t feel I needed to call for professional help, so I continued monitoring and concentrated on breathing and over the next few hours my oxygen increased to steady 91%. Then next few days my oxygen levels increased step by step until they were consistently teetering around 99%.

    I used it on my mum who also had covid at same time. She was feeling very ill but we were unsure whether to call for professional help. This device showed her oxygen levels were in the low 80s. The easy to read advice card supplied with the device advised to call for immediate help. We decided to take that advice and an ambulance arrived whose equipment confirmed the readings this device gave us and she was taken to hospital where they diagnosed a lung infection which needed treatment.

    Our experience having covid was a bit of a rough ride and the brain fog part of it did not help us make clear decisions but this oximeter was a really useful tool in helping us deal with our journey and make sensible decisions, so I’d recommend it.
